Role Overview

Kodak is looking for a Manufacturing Production Operator to join the Finishing Organization in Kodak's Advanced Materials and Chemicals Division in Rochester, NY. In this position you will work in a great environment with a bright future. As a Manufacturing Production Operator you will be working with a small Film Storage Team responsible for wrapping film rolls, maintaining and inspecting film boxes, film-cores and carriers, and transporting pallets of material and finished product within the building.

AS A MANUFACTURING PRODUCTION OPERATOR YOU WILL:

* Complete all required Operator training programs
* Transport incoming and outgoing film boxes throughout the facility
* Inspect and maintain the quality of film boxes, roll cores, and carriers to meet production standards
* Conveyance of incoming and outgoing pallets of raw materials and finished products
* Periodically work in dark room environment, wrapping large film rolls with accuracy and safety
* Rotate through various jobs as needed within the Film Storage Team
* Collaborate closely with Finishing staff and the Operations Team to ensure smooth and timely production processes.
